Our Services
1) Employee Data Preparation & Analysis
2) End-of-Service Benefit Calculations
3) IAS 19 Liability Valuation
We review, validate, and organize employee records, payroll data, length of service, and workforce categories to ensure the information used in the valuation is complete, accurate, and reliable. This analysis also helps identify the key factors influencing the size of the obligation and the distribution of costs across the organization.
We calculate end-of-service benefit obligations based on employee data, salary levels, length of service, and the organization’s approved benefit entitlement policies, using a rigorous and reviewable methodology.
We prepare valuations and supporting outputs in accordance with IAS 19 requirements, including the recognized liability, expense for the reporting period, and movements in the obligation throughout the year.
4) Financial & Actuarial Assumption Development
We support the development of appropriate financial and actuarial assumptions that reflect the organization’s characteristics and underlying data, including discount rates, salary growth, employee turnover, and the expected timing of benefit payments.
5) Sensitivity & Risk Analysis
We assess the impact of changes in key assumptions on the value of employee benefit obligations and highlight the associated financial risks, enabling management to plan more effectively and make better-informed decisions.
6) Reporting & External Audit Support
We deliver clear, professionally structured financial and management reports that combine technical rigor with practical clarity. We also provide organized supporting documentation and valuation outputs that enable management, finance teams, and external auditors to understand the methodology, review the results, and rely on them with confidence.
